Dr. Gaffar earned his Doctor of Medicine (M.D.) degree from Saba University School of Medicine, where his early dedication to medical excellence began. His foundational medical education instilled in him a strong sense of responsibility, discipline, and commitment to patient care.

Following medical school, he completed his residency at Rutgers–Robert Wood Johnson Medical School. During this time, he distinguished himself as a leader among his peers and was appointed Chief Resident. This leadership role helped refine both his clinical expertise and interpersonal skills, shaping an approach to care that balances technical precision with human connection. These formative years were critical in defining his professional identity and preparing him for a career in oncology.

Driven by a desire to advance cancer treatment, Dr. Gaffar pursued a fellowship in Medical Oncology and Hematology at the USF–Moffitt Cancer Center, an institution known for its research-driven culture. During his fellowship, he conducted focused research in Genitourinary (GU) Oncology and Senior Adult Oncology. These experiences provided specialized knowledge that continues to influence his clinical practice today. Dr. Gaffar is board-certified in both hematology and medical oncology and remains committed to ongoing education to maintain the highest standards of care.
